Baker Hughes and GE Receive

By June 20, 2017Uncategorized

HOUSTON–(BUSINESS WIRE)–May 31, 2017– Baker Hughes Incorporated (NYSE:BHI) and General Electric Company (NYSE:GE) announced today that the European Commission has cleared the proposed transaction between Baker Hughes and GE’s oil and gas business under EU merger control rules. The companies remain confident in the value that the combined company will deliver to its customers, employees, shareholders and to the oil and gas industry. Baker Hughes and GE continue to work constructively with regulators and expect to close the transaction in mid-2017.

About Baker Hughes

Baker Hughes is a leading supplier of oilfield services, products, technology and systems to the worldwide oil and natural gas industry. The company’s 32,000 employees today work in more than 80 countries helping customers find, evaluate, drill, produce, transport and process hydrocarbon resources.
